There are some nickels, dimes, and quarters in a large piggy bank. For every 2 nickels there dimes. For every 2 dimes there are 5 quarters. There are 500 coins total. a. How many nickels, dimes, and quarters are in the piggy bank? Explain your reasoning.

Let the equation be: n + d + q = 500 let this be 1
n/2 = d/3 (for every 2 nickels there are 3 dimes) let this
be 2
d/2 = q/5 (for every 2 dimes, there are 5 quarters) let this
be 3
from 2, n = 2/3d
from 3, q = 5/2d
substitute the given values into equation 1:
2/3d + d + 5/2d = 500
Multiply by 6 both sides
4d + 6d + 15d = 3000
25d = 3000
d = 3000/25
d = 120
answer: 120 dimes, 2/3 x 120 = 80 nickels and 5/2 x 120 =
300 quarters.
